Position Description: Senior Azure Cloud Engineer with Project Management Experience Position Summary (Must be US Citizen)
Crest Security Assurance is seeking a skilled Azure Cloud Engineer with 5–7 years of hands-on experience in Microsoft Azure, Windows IT administration, and cloud networking. The Azure Cloud Engineer will design, implement, and maintain secure, scalable, and efficient Azure environments supporting enterprise and mission systems.
This position requires a deep understanding of Azure infrastructure services, Windows Server and Active Directory administration, Azure Virtual Desktop (AVD), and system hardening following STIGs or CIS Benchmarks. The ideal candidate will also have experience using Microsoft Intune and Azure tools to connect, configure, and manage physical and hybrid devices, as well as developing Infrastructure as Code (IaC) for rapid, repeatable deployments.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op a project Road Map/Plan (MS Project or Excel) that breaks out the task and subtasks for the project
- Design, deploy, and manage Azure cloud environments, including virtual networks, compute, and hybrid integrations.
- Administer Windows Server, Active Directory, and Group Policy in both on-premises and cloud-hosted environments.
- Configure, deploy, and manage Azure Virtual Desktop (AVD) environments for multi-user access and enterprise workloads.
- Implement system and cloud hardening following DoD STIGs, CIS Benchmarks, and security best practices.
- Automate environment provisioning, configuration management, and patching using Infrastructure as Code (IaC) (e.g., Terraform, Bicep, PowerShell DSC, or Nerido templates).
- Use Microsoft Intune and Azure services to connect, configure, and manage physical devices, ensuring secure and consistent endpoint configurations.
- Manage Azure networking, including VPN gateways, Network Security Groups (NSGs), firewalls, and private endpoints.
- Monitor performance, security, and cost efficiency of Azure resources using native tools such as Azure Monitor and Defender for Cloud.
- Collaborate with IT teams to ensure integration, reliability, and compliance across environments.
- Develop and maintain technical documentation, architecture diagrams, and operational procedures.
